Brookhaven Academy sweeps Bowling Green School to end season

Published 1:00 pm Saturday, April 19, 2025

The 2025 baseball season finished up at Brookhaven Academy this week with a three game sweep of Bowling Green School. The Cougars finish the year wit a 11-17 record and a five-game winning streak, which included a sweep of Bowling Green (14-0, 12-0, 7-0).

Senior Luke Simmons pitched the win in game one on Wednesday, a 12-0 victory for BA. Simmons gave up one hit and struck out six while walking one.

Freshman Case Simmons and junior Walt Smith doubled in that win while Tucker Tarver tripled, and Caleb Authement hit a home run.

Simmons is one of three seniors on the team, along with Liam Magee and Carter Case. Both sophomores, Tarver had three RBIs in the win and Authement had five.

Magee pitched the first four innings of game two on Wednesday and was then relieved by his classmate, Case. Magee struck out two and gave up no hits. Case gave up one hit and struck out five Buccaneers.

Carter Case had three RBIs in game two and Tarver also drove in three runs.

Smith pitched the series opener on Monday in Franklinton, Louisiana. He struck out four and gave up one hit. Sophomore Nic Cline had two doubles on Monday and Smith had one as well. Cline finished the night with six RBIs.
